| #include <string> |
| |
| #include <stout/foreach.hpp> |
| #include <stout/lambda.hpp> |
| #include <stout/hashmap.hpp> |
| |
| #include "uri/fetcher.hpp" |
| |
| using std::string; |
| using std::vector; |
| |
| using process::Failure; |
| using process::Future; |
| using process::Owned; |
| using process::Shared; |
| |
| namespace mesos { |
| namespace uri { |
| namespace fetcher { |
| |
| Try<Owned<Fetcher>> create(const Option<Flags>& _flags) |
| { |
| // Use the default flags if not specified. |
| Flags flags; |
| if (_flags.isSome()) { |
| flags = _flags.get(); |
| } |
| |
| // Load built-in plugins. |
| typedef lambda::function<Try<Owned<Fetcher::Plugin>>()> Creator; |
| |
| hashmap<string, Creator> creators = { |
| {CurlFetcherPlugin::NAME, |
| [flags]() { return CurlFetcherPlugin::create(flags); }}, |
| {CopyFetcherPlugin::NAME, |
| [flags]() { return CopyFetcherPlugin::create(flags); }}, |
| {HadoopFetcherPlugin::NAME, |
| [flags]() { return HadoopFetcherPlugin::create(flags); }}, |
| #ifndef __WINDOWS__ |
| {DockerFetcherPlugin::NAME, |
| [flags]() { return DockerFetcherPlugin::create(flags); }}, |
| #endif // __WINDOWS__ |
| }; |
| |
| vector<Owned<Fetcher::Plugin>> plugins; |
| |
| foreachpair (const string& name, const Creator& creator, creators) { |
| Try<Owned<Fetcher::Plugin>> plugin = creator(); |
| if (plugin.isError()) { |
| // NOTE: We skip the plugin if it cannot be created, instead of |
| // returning an Error so that we can still use other plugins. |
| LOG(INFO) << "Skipping URI fetcher plugin " << "'" << name << "' " |
| << "as it could not be created: " << plugin.error(); |
| continue; |
| } |
| |
| plugins.push_back(plugin.get()); |
| } |
| |
| return Owned<Fetcher>(new Fetcher(plugins)); |
| } |
| |
| } // namespace fetcher { |
| |
| Fetcher::Fetcher(const vector<Owned<Plugin>>& plugins) |
| { |
| foreach (Owned<Plugin> _plugin, plugins) { |
| Shared<Plugin> plugin = _plugin.share(); |
| |
| if (pluginsByName.contains(plugin->name())) { |
| LOG(WARNING) << "Multiple URI fetcher plugins register " |
| << "under name '" << plugin->name() << "'"; |
| } |
| |
| pluginsByName[plugin->name()] = plugin; |
| |
| foreach (const string& scheme, plugin->schemes()) { |
| if (pluginsByScheme.contains(scheme)) { |
| LOG(WARNING) << "Multiple URI fetcher plugins register " |
| << "URI scheme '" << scheme << "'"; |
| } |
| |
| pluginsByScheme[scheme] = plugin; |
| } |
| } |
| } |
| |
| |
| Future<Nothing> Fetcher::fetch( |
| const URI& uri, |
| const string& directory, |
| const Option<string>& data, |
| const Option<string>& outputFileName) const |
| { |
| if (!pluginsByScheme.contains(uri.scheme())) { |
| return Failure("Scheme '" + uri.scheme() + "' is not supported"); |
| } |
| |
| return pluginsByScheme.at(uri.scheme())->fetch( |
| uri, |
| directory, |
| data, |
| outputFileName); |
| } |
| |
| |
| Future<Nothing> Fetcher::fetch( |
| const URI& uri, |
| const string& directory, |
| const string& name, |
| const Option<string>& data, |
| const Option<string>& outputFileName) const |
| { |
| if (!pluginsByName.contains(name)) { |
| return Failure("Plugin '" + name + "' is not registered."); |
| } |
| |
| return pluginsByName.at(name)->fetch(uri, directory, data, outputFileName); |
| } |
| |
| } // namespace uri { |
| } // namespace mesos { |
